French SIM card for occasional use

I would be very grateful for advice on getting a French SIM card for occasional use. While UK based, I have a second home in France, which I visit for 3-4 months a year, for between 4 & 6 weeks at a time. It would be helpful to have a French phone number. The prime use will be for calls and texts, rather than for Data. I would not plan to use it outside of France, unless occasional use is required to keep the card valid. I am not very keen on a monthly contract, as there will be periods of no use, even without another bout of Covid travel difficulties.

I’ve just got a Reglo mobile Mini+ SIM card for occasional use if/when our landline is down. I have a question for people who are more familiar with it…
The blurb that comes with is seems to say that I have to have a direct debit with them, either to top it up if if falls below 5 euros or for a regular amount per month. Obviously the first one is more appropriate but I was wondering if I had to do either, provided I kept a decent balance on it?

Any experience/understanding you feel like sharing will be much appreciated :smiley:

I’m sure it used to be the case that you didn’t - indeed, we didn’t when we had Reglo mobiles - and when we moved to Bouygues, we just left the “credit” to expire. IIRC they provided warnings that the account would be lost within a specified period if we didn’t top up but since we’d moved elsewhere, it had no consequences for us.
When we were using the account regularly, we topped up on line as opposed to using an abonnement.
